Technical Specifications

Parameter NameValue
TypeParameter
Factory Lead Time 19 Weeks
Mount Through Hole
Mounting Type Through Hole
Package / Case Radial, Can
Terminal Shape WIRE
Dielectric MaterialALUMINUM (WET)
Operating Temperature-40°C~85°C
PackagingBulk
Published 2012
Series UFG
Size / Dimension 0.394Dia 10.00mm
Tolerance ±20%
JESD-609 Code e3
Pbfree Code yes
Part StatusActive
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Number of Terminations 2
Termination Radial
ECCN Code EAR99
Terminal Finish Matte Tin (Sn)
Applications Audio
HTS Code8532.22.00
Capacitance 470μF
Voltage - Rated DC 10V
Packing Method TAPE
Terminal Pitch5mm
Lead Pitch 5.0038mm
Capacitor Type ALUMINUM ELECTROLYTIC CAPACITOR
Lead Spacing0.197 5.00mm
Lifetime @ Temp 1000 Hrs @ 85°C
Leakage Current 3μA
Ripple Current330mA
Polarization Polar
Life (Hours) 1000 hours
Ripple Current @ Low Frequency 330mA @ 120Hz
Dissipation Factor0.19 %
Diameter 10mm
Height 16mm
Height Seated (Max) 0.689 17.50mm
RoHS StatusROHS3 Compliant
